Python将内容追加到文件

1. 介绍

本文旨在教会刚入行的小白如何使用Python将内容追加到文件。作为经验丰富的开发者,我将提供整个过程的流程,并详细说明每一步需要做什么,包括使用的代码和代码的注释。

2. 流程图

下面是整个过程的流程图,描述了从开始到结束的步骤。

graph TB
A(开始) --> B(打开文件)
B --> C(写入内容)
C --> D(关闭文件)
D --> E(完成)

3. 步骤说明

步骤1:打开文件

首先,我们需要打开一个文件,以便将内容追加到其中。我们可以使用open()函数来打开文件。以下是相应的代码和注释:

# 打开文件以追加内容
file = open("filename.txt", "a")

代码解释:

  • open()函数用于打开文件。
  • 第一个参数是文件名,可以是绝对路径或相对路径。在这个例子中,我们将文件名设置为"filename.txt"。
  • 第二个参数是打开文件的模式。在这里,我们使用了"a"模式,表示追加内容到文件的末尾。

步骤2:写入内容

接下来,我们需要将内容写入到文件中。我们可以使用write()函数来写入内容。以下是相应的代码和注释:

# 写入内容
file.write("这是要追加的内容")

代码解释:

  • write()函数用于将内容写入文件。
  • 参数是要写入文件的内容。在这个例子中,我们将内容设置为"这是要追加的内容"。

步骤3:关闭文件

最后,我们需要关闭文件,以确保文件被正确地保存和释放资源。我们可以使用close()函数来关闭文件。以下是相应的代码和注释:

# 关闭文件
file.close()

代码解释:

  • close()函数用于关闭文件。
  • 没有参数。

步骤4:完成

完成了以上步骤后,我们已经成功地将内容追加到文件中。现在,文件中应该包含我们追加的内容。

4. 完整代码示例

下面是一个完整的示例代码,展示了如何将内容追加到文件中:

# 打开文件以追加内容
file = open("filename.txt", "a")

# 写入内容
file.write("这是要追加的内容")

# 关闭文件
file.close()

5. 甘特图

下面是使用甘特图展示的整个过程的时间安排:

gantt
    title Python将内容追加到文件流程图

    section 过程
    打开文件     :a1, 2022-01-01, 1d
    写入内容     :a2, after a1, 1d
    关闭文件     :a3, after a2, 1d
    完成         :a4, after a3, 1d

6. 类图

由于本文只介绍了如何将内容追加到文件,因此没有涉及具体的类。因此,在这里没有类图。

7. 总结

在本文中,我详细介绍了如何使用Python将内容追加到文件中。通过提供整个过程的流程图、每个步骤的代码和注释,以及甘特图,希望能够帮助刚入行的小白快速掌握这个技巧。请记住在完成写入操作后关闭文件,以确保数据正确保存并释放资源。